Techniques That Hook Pike
Pike fishing isn't rocket science, but it takes the right approach to consistently connect with quality fish. Captain Mike specializes in proven techniques that trigger strikes from these aggressive hunters. We'll be working everything from shallow weed flats where pike cruise for easy meals to deeper structure where the bigger fish hang out during tougher conditions. The captain's arsenal includes heavy-action rods paired with reels that can handle sudden runs and violent head shakes - pike don't come to the boat quietly. Steel leaders are non-negotiable when targeting these toothy critters, and Captain Mike makes sure every setup is pike-ready from the moment lines hit the water. Depending on conditions and seasonal patterns, we might be casting large spoons that flash and wobble through the water column, burning spinnerbaits over weed tops, or working soft plastics along bottom structure. The boat's equipped with quality electronics to mark structure and locate baitfish concentrations that attract pike. Captain Mike's local knowledge really shines when it comes to reading water and understanding how weather, water temperature, and time of day affect pike behavior and positioning.
Species You'll Want to Hook
Northern Pike are the ultimate freshwater predator and the star of every fishing trip with Captain Mike. These underwater wolves can stretch over 40 inches and pack serious weight, with fish in the 8-12 pound range being common catches and larger specimens always a possibility. Pike are active throughout much of the fishing season, but they really turn on during cooler water periods in spring and fall when they're feeding aggressively to prepare for spawn or winter. What makes pike fishing so addictive is their explosive strike - there's no mistaking when a pike hammers your lure. These fish are built for speed and power, with torpedo-shaped bodies and mouths full of razor-sharp teeth that can shred unprepared tackle in seconds. Pike are ambush predators that lurk in weedy cover, along structure edges, and near drop-offs where they can surprise unsuspecting prey. They're not picky eaters either - pike will attack everything from small panfish to large suckers, which is why big lures often produce the best results. The fight is what keeps anglers coming back for more. Pike jump, run, and throw their heads violently trying to shake hooks, making every hookup an adventure. Even smaller pike in the 20-inch range fight like fish twice their size, and when you hook into a true trophy pike pushing 15-20 pounds, you'll understand why these fish have such a devoted following among serious freshwater anglers.
